IOpcSignatureReference::GetId method
Gets the identifier for the reference.
Syntax
HRESULT GetId( [out, retval] LPCWSTR *referenceId );
Parameters
- referenceId [out, retval]
-
An identifier for the reference.
If the identifier is not set, referenceId will be the empty string, "".

Remarks
This method allocates memory used by the string returned in referenceId. If the method succeeds, call the CoTaskMemFree function to free the memory.
Providing an identifier for a reference is optional. If used, the identifier is serialized as the optional Id attribute of a Reference element in the signature markup.
Thread Safety
Packaging objects are not thread-safe.
